Transaction 7450ce882a5537c679995b7402090200bde2ccc11db3131a29072f21246dc40d
2 Input
2 Outputs
- 7450ce882a5537c679995b7402090200bde2ccc11db3131a29072f21246dc40d:0
- 7450ce882a5537c679995b7402090200bde2ccc11db3131a29072f21246dc40d:1
value 181392
address 14HbDy7kQsLyLSrmWaCWPnNLgtpFSDTdvq
value 2543583
address 3BKkr8DZiUiVQTqogBM2QDGs4sYJnnhoCo